On the contrary, I think a cartridge bottom bracket could be a disaster if you can't easily get a replacement. The old-style BBs with loose ball bearings (non-sealed) can last far longer than the sealed units, but require periodic maintenance. The sealed units are taken for granted as preferable in developed countries because you can just order another one, usually for less than $50. But that's not your situation. You'd have to wait until you could obtain one from out-of-country.
This is also my understanding. The only downside with sealed BB is that its more complicated to open. On in other words you need more tools that I'm not familiar with. What about wheel hubs? Would you go with cartridge or cup n cone?
